(TSXV: CBR) (OTC Pink: CBGZF) (\"Cabral\" or the \"Company\") is pleased to provide assay results from ten additional RC holes at the Pau de Merenda (\"PDM\") gold-in-oxide blanket target located 2.5km NW of the Central gold deposit at the Cuiú Cuiú gold district. Highlights are as follows:Results from an additional ten RC drill holes at the PDM target have further expanded the recently identified gold-in-oxide blanket to 900 x 350m in size from the initial 200 x 400m. The blanket remains open to the north and westAssay results include 13m @ 0.9 g/t gold from surface and 10m @ 0.6 g/t gold including 1m @ 6.2 g/t gold. Previous results in the gold-in-oxide blanket at PDM include 40m @ 2.2 g/t goldThe RC drilling in the blanket at PDM continues to define a NW trending zone of higher grade gold mineralization in the surface gold-in-oxide material. This zone is now 500m in strike length and still open along strike and may indicate the presence of an underlying primary zone of gold mineralization in the hard rock which eroded to form the PDM gold-in-oxide blanket Alan Carter, Cabral's President and CEO commented, \"These additional RC drill results have again expanded the gold-in-oxide blanket at the PDM target at Cuiú Cuiú, and the mineralized zone is still open to the north and west. Perhaps more significantly, these drill results further confirm the presence of a NW-trending zone of higher-grade gold-in-oxide mineralization which may represent an underlying primary gold deposit at PDM. If so, this could represent a significant extension to the Central gold deposit which is located 2.5km along strike to the south-east. Deeper diamond drilling is currently in progress aimed at testing for the presence of an underlying primary gold deposit.\"PDM RC DrillingThe PDM target is located approximately 2.5km NW of the Central gold deposit at Cuiú Cuiú (Figure 1) and comprises a significant gold-in-soil anomaly. Limited historic diamond drilling (nine holes totaling 2,593m) at this target previously returned encouraging drill results within the underlying bedrock including 30m @ 1.1 g/t gol...
